Abstract

The invention relates to a digital image processing method which comprises the following steps: successively carrying out video enhancement, video analysis and video understanding on highway video images acquired by a camera. As for the video enhancement, multiple low-resolution images of the same scene and with different exposure parameters are reconstructed into high-quality images with highlight brightness dynamic range and high resolution, thus providing high-quality video images for the video analysis level and raising reliability of video processing results. As for the video analysis, detection is carried out through moving objects, and space-time object characteristics of video ground and middle levels are extracted by motion estimation and target tracking video analytic algorithms so as to provide inferential basis for event identification in high-level video processing. As for the video understanding, identification of surveillance video events is completed by analyzing and understanding the space-time object characteristics provided by the video analysis level. According to the invention, types of detection events are broader and precision is higher. Through correct identification of events, automatic control of highways is ensured.

technical field [0001] The invention relates to a digital image processing method, in particular to a sample-based HDR and HR image reconstruction method for expressway video. Background technique [0002] There are many factors that affect image quality, such as spatial resolution, brightness contrast, noise, etc. High-quality images should have high spatial resolution while effectively representing high-contrast scenes. Aiming at the problem of high dynamic range image display and spatial resolution reconstruction of images, many scholars have carried out some fruitful research work, but they are basically carried out independently. Existing super-resolution restoration techniques usually assume that the exposure parameters of multiple images are constant, and the parameters of the camera response function and the noise parameters are known.
